Output df85617e1fe42dc318add1e99da30b87724295196d5106133fc2b6d7a8598c83:28

value
119544
script pubkey
OP_0 OP_PUSHBYTES_20 1442b618ce2d4a60b7fee6de9881a92d8d51d4e3
address
bc1qz3ptvxxw949xpdl7um0f3qdf9kx4r48rv6rdn9
transaction
df85617e1fe42dc318add1e99da30b87724295196d5106133fc2b6d7a8598c83
confirmations
66087
spent
true